Tate has an opportunity for an experienced Employee Relations Lead to join a busy operational business on a temporary basis for an initial 2–3-month assignment. This is a hands-on role requiring a confident employee relations specialist who can quickly take ownership of a high-volume caseload and provide expert guidance to managers and senior stakeholders.

For this we are seeking someone experienced at handling complex issues, preferably from an industrial and trade union related business environment.

Key Responsibilities
  • Manage complex employee relations cases including disciplinary, grievance, absence, capability and performance matters.
  • Provide expert advice on employment law, policies and best practice.
  • Manage employment tribunal cases and liaise with legal representatives where required.
  • Support organisational change projects, including restructures, redundancy consultations and TUPE activities.
  • Build effective relationships with trade unions and support consultation and negotiation processes.
  • Coach and support managers in handling employee relations issues confidently and consistently.
  • Ensure compliance with employment legislation, company policies and governance standards.
  • Identify trends, mitigate risk and drive continuous improvement across employee relations processes.
About You
  • CIPD qualified (Level 5 preferred) or equivalent experience.
  • Significant employee relations experience within logistics, supply chain, manufacturing or another fast-paced operational environment.
  • Proven track record of managing complex and high-volume employee relations cases from start to finish.
  • Strong knowledge of UK employment law and employment tribunal processes.
  • Experience working with trade unions and managing industrial relations matters.
  • Excellent communication, influencing and stakeholder management skills.
  • Strong attention to detail, sound judgement and a commercially focused approach.
  • Passionate about creating fair, inclusive and effective workplace practices.
